THE Government of India showed both a commendable wisdom and a grasp of the realities of the situation in publishing an abstract of the main statistics of the census of 1931 while the Third Round Table Conference was still in session in London. WebDuring the British period, several estimates of national income were made by Dadabhai Naoroji (1868), William Digby (1899), Findlay Shirras (1911, 1922 and 1934), Shah and Khambatta (1921), V.K.R.V. Rao (1925-29) and R.C. Desai (1931-40): Among all these pre-independence estimates of national income in India, the estimates of Naoroji, Findlay ...
